Editorial Reviews

Product Description

Yale Univ., New Haven, CT. Text providing comprehensive coverage of dissociation and memory alterations in trauma. For researchers and clinicians. 24 contributors, 18 U.S. DNLM: Stress Disorders, Post-Traumatic.


About the Author

J. Douglas Bremner, M.D., is Assistant Professor of Psychiatry at the Yale University School of Medicine and Research Psychiatrist at Yale Psychiatric Institute and the National Center for Posttraumatic Stress Disorder at the West Haven Veterans Administration Medical Center, West Haven, Connecticut. Charles R. Marmar, M.D., is Professor and Vice-Chair in the Department of Psychiatry at the University of California, San Francisco; and Chief, Mental Health Services at the Department of Veterans Affairs Medical Center, San Francisco, California. Dr. Marmar has authored or edited over 100 publications on the topic of traumatic stress and related disorders. --This text refers to the Paperback edition.
